What is Outbound Sales?

Outbound sales refer to the process where sales representatives initiate contact with potential customers, as opposed to inbound sales where customers reach out to the business. The primary goal of outbound sales is to generate leads, qualify prospects, and convert them into paying customers.

Key Components of Outbound Sales:

  1. Prospecting: Identifying and researching potential leads who may be interested in your product or service.
  2. Cold Outreach: Initiating contact with leads through various channels such as phone calls, emails, and social media.
  3. Lead Qualification: Assessing the potential of leads to determine if they are a good fit for your offering.
  4. Sales Pitch: Presenting your product or service to the prospect in a compelling manner.
  5. Follow-Up: Maintaining contact with leads to nurture relationships and move them through the sales funnel.

Why Outbound Sales Matter for SMEs

Outbound sales are particularly crucial for SMEs for several reasons:

  • Proactive Lead Generation: Outbound sales allow SMEs to actively seek out potential customers rather than waiting for them to come. This proactive approach can significantly accelerate growth.
  • Market Penetration: By reaching out to a broader audience, SMEs can increase their market presence and brand awareness.
  • Control Over the Sales Process: Outbound sales provide greater control over the sales process, enabling SMEs to tailor their approach to different segments.

Effective Outbound Sales Strategies

To succeed in outbound sales, it’s essential to implement strategies that are both efficient and effective. Here are some key strategies to consider:

1. Build a Strong Prospect List

The foundation of any successful outbound sales campaign is a well-curated prospect list. Use data-driven tools and resources to identify potential leads who fit your ideal customer profile (ICP).

2. Craft Personalized Outreach Messages

Generic, impersonal messages are unlikely to resonate with your prospects. Take the time to personalize your outreach by addressing the recipient’s pain points and explaining how your solution can add value.

3. Utilize Multi-Channel Outreach

Don’t rely solely on one communication channel. Combine phone calls, emails, social media, and even direct mail to increase your chances of reaching your prospects.

4. Implement a Lead Scoring System

Not all leads are created equal. Use a lead scoring system to prioritize leads based on factors such as their level of interest, engagement, and fit with your ICP. This will help you focus your efforts on the most promising prospects.

5. Master the Art of Cold Calling

Cold calling remains a powerful tool in outbound sales. To master it, ensure you have a clear script, anticipate objections, and maintain a positive and confident demeanor throughout the call.

6. Leverage Sales Automation Tools

Sales automation tools can streamline many aspects of the outbound sales process, from prospecting to follow-up. Tools like CRM systems, email automation, and analytics platforms can save time and improve efficiency.

Overcoming Common Outbound Sales Challenges

Outbound sales can be challenging, but understanding and addressing common obstacles can help you achieve better results.

Challenge 1: High Rejection Rates

Rejection is an inherent part of outbound sales. To overcome this, develop resilience, continuously refine your pitch, and learn from each interaction to improve future efforts.

Challenge 2: Difficulty in Reaching Decision-Makers

Decision-makers are often busy and hard to reach. Use a multi-channel approach, leverage referrals, and ensure your value proposition is compelling enough to capture their attention.

Challenge 3: Managing Follow-Ups

Effective follow-up is crucial for converting leads. Use CRM tools to manage and automate follow-up tasks, and always add value in each interaction to keep prospects engaged.

Measuring Outbound Sales Success

To gauge the effectiveness of your outbound sales efforts, it’s important to track and analyze key performance indicators (KPIs). Some important KPIs to consider include:

  • Number of Leads Generated: The total number of leads generated through outbound efforts.
  • Conversion Rate: The percentage of leads that convert into paying customers.
  • Cost Per Lead (CPL): The cost associated with acquiring each lead.
  • Average Deal Size: The average revenue generated from each sale.
  • Sales Cycle Length: The average time it takes to convert a lead into a customer.

By regularly monitoring these KPIs, you can identify areas for improvement and optimize your outbound sales strategies for better results.
